opschonen files voor toevoegen repository

Pagina: 1
Acties:

  • morpheus
  • Registratie: November 1999
  • Laatst online: 23:39
Ik zit met het volgende.

Een huidige applicatie wil ik op dit moment in een repository stoppen, hierbij wil ik echter enkel de sourcebestanden erin hebben of een gecompileerde versie indien een sourcebestand niet beschikbaar is.

Hoe kan ik mijn huidige omgeving nu zodanig opschonen zodat ik dit voor elkaar krijg en niet onbedoeld verkeerde files ook weggooi?

Kortom ik heb iets nodig dat controleerd of van "programmacode.java" de "programmacode.class" weggooid indien het eerste gevonden is.

del "programmacode.class" gaat dus niet want dan kan het zijn dat ik teveel weggooi.

Bestaat hier een tool voor?

[ Voor 13% gewijzigd door morpheus op 13-10-2004 15:11 ]

3kwp pvoutput


  • -FoX-
  • Registratie: Januari 2002
  • Niet online

-FoX-

Carpe Diem!

Je kan misschien eens naar ANT kijken en hiervoor een "task" aanmaken. Should do the trick! :)

  • morpheus
  • Registratie: November 1999
  • Laatst online: 23:39
Ik hoopte eigenlijk op iets simpelers, een wat meer recht door zeer oplossing in plaats van een complete buildtool die ik enkel voor deze taak zou moeten installeren.

Maar ik twijfel er niet aan dat ant de taak zou kunnen klaren :)

Overigens, ik heb hier java als voorbeeld genoemd. Het is echter van een andere taal, maar die zal niet iedereen hier kennen :)

3kwp pvoutput


  • Infinitive
  • Registratie: Maart 2001
  • Laatst online: 25-09-2023
Je gebruikt een repository bijvoorbeeld om te voorkomen dat je dingen niet per ongeluk weggooit, maar voordat je het kan gebruiken ben je bang dat je teveel dingen weggooit? :) -> stop alles in de repository.

Tja, ik weet niet over hoeveel files het gaat, maar waarom niet eerst alles toevoegen, commit, daarna alle "derived objects" (gecompileerde code) wegmikken, commit, vervolgens je applicatie bouwen en al de files terughalen die je nu mist?

Of bedoel jij iets anders met een repository dan een CVS achtig systeem?

[ Voor 46% gewijzigd door Infinitive op 13-10-2004 15:24 ]

putStr $ map (x -> chr $ round $ 21/2 * x^3 - 92 * x^2 + 503/2 * x - 105) [1..4]


  • morpheus
  • Registratie: November 1999
  • Laatst online: 23:39
Infinitive schreef op 13 oktober 2004 @ 15:20:
Je gebruikt een repository bijvoorbeeld om te voorkomen dat je dingen niet per ongeluk weggooit, maar voordat je het kan gebruiken ben je bang dat je teveel dingen weggooit? :) -> stop alles in de repository.
Ik verwacht dat het 500MB tot misschien 750MB in de repository kan schelen op de 1,5GB
Tja, ik weet niet over hoeveel files het gaat, maar waarom niet eerst alles toevoegen, commit, daarna alle "derived objects" (gecompileerde code) wegmikken, commit, vervolgens je applicatie bouwen en al de files terughalen die je nu mist?

Of bedoel jij iets anders met een repository dan een CVS achtig systeem?
Nee, ik heb het inderdaad over een CVS achtig systeem (subversion in dit geval).

Je methode zal waarschijnlijk in veel gevallen werken, echter is deze omgeving te complex en te groot waardoor ik eerder een foutmelding verwacht bij het builden waardoor je methode niet zal werken. Dit door afhankelijkheden van de gecompileerde bestanden waarvan er geen source is.

3kwp pvoutput


  • Macros
  • Registratie: Februari 2000
  • Laatst online: 30-04 09:28

Macros

I'm watching...

Schrijf je een klein programmaatje in Java die een lijst maakt met .class files waarvan de .java wel bestaat.

"Beauty is the ultimate defence against complexity." David Gelernter


  • morpheus
  • Registratie: November 1999
  • Laatst online: 23:39
Macros schreef op 13 oktober 2004 @ 15:31:
Schrijf je een klein programmaatje in Java die een lijst maakt met .class files waarvan de .java wel bestaat.
Ik heb hier geen java omgeving tot de beschikking om dat even snel te schrijven. Inderdaad is het zelf schrijven van een dergelijk programmaatje geen probleem.

Indien er geen bekend tooltje is of command shell scripts niet toereikend zijn (windows xp) denk ik dat ik vanavond thuis snel iets dergelijks in elkaar flans.

3kwp pvoutput

Pagina: 1